What Happens When Something Goes Wrong?

When casino payments or bonuses go wrong, VIP hosts coordinate finance and support — documenting the case until resolution.

Something will go wrong eventually — missing credit, delayed wire, bonus blocking cashout. Process matters.

First contact

Message your host with IDs, screenshots, timestamps. Avoid parallel angry tickets that contradict each other.

Internal routing

Hosts determine whether finance, payments, or game providers own the issue at the casino.

Escalation ladders

If loops repeat, request VIP leadership involvement calmly.

Learning for next time

Post-mortem: could verification have been proactive? Was bonus acceptance necessary?

Large withdrawals without panic

Size triggers enhanced diligence — plan buffer days, avoid changing methods mid-review, and notify your host before unusually large sessions so compliance is not surprised. VIP advocacy adds context; it does not erase banking hours or AML rules.

Transparency from the casino during large reviews is itself a VIP quality signal.

Building a payment playbook

Maintain a personal checklist: verified documents on file, preferred method tested at moderate size, host contact saved outside the casino app. When urgency hits, you execute the checklist instead of improvising under stress.

Players with playbooks report calmer outcomes even when timelines are objectively slow.

Reading finance status language

Phrases like "processing," "review," and "pending provider" mean different things at different operators. Ask your host to define each stage in writing once — reuse that map when future withdrawals stall. the casino uses internal vocabulary daily; you should not have to decode it fresh every time.

Precision reduces duplicate tickets that slow everyone down.
